Position: Medical Writer
Location: Texas
Company Summary:
Our client has been established to develop and conduct quality medical education programs for physicians and other health care professionals.
Description:
Primary responsibilities include:
- Responsible for the development of content for enduring materials, slide sets, and manuscripts
- Travels to scientific meetings to gather data for planned or potential publications
- Assists Educational Program Services (EPS) in the development of agendas for scientific meetings and provides executive summaries following meetings
- Provides input for the development of scientifically accurate graphic concepts for meetings and programs
- Scans scientific and medical literature regularly and disseminates all relevant study results to EPS
- Communicates with thought leaders to ensure accuracy and quality of content in scientific project
